Understanding the Givenchy Mr. Light Family:
The Givenchy Mr. Light range primarily revolves around the concept of instant complexion correction and radiance enhancement. It aims to achieve this through a lightweight, fluid formula that seamlessly blends into the skin, providing coverage without feeling heavy or cakey. The core of the product line’s success lies in its unique Actiwake Complex, a proprietary blend of multivitamin-charged plant extracts designed to revitalize and brighten the skin. This, coupled with the inclusion of SPF 10, makes it a versatile product for everyday use.
